Another argument to throw back at them would be that silicon is not as "space efficient" as DSC.
Silicon panels need to mounted on a suitable surface, in many cases the available room for mounting them is limited.
Silicon panels are also quite heavy which limits them even further.
eg: I use a small campervan (pop-top Toyota Hiace), I have been looking into solar panels to top up the batteries when in the bush. For $500 I could buy a large, bulky panel which would need a mounting frame on the roof. It would require 5000mm x 5000mm of operating space (as well as storage space when in transit).
Alternatively using DSC, the entire roof could be generating power - no bulk, no storage, no repositioning, no weight.
Anything which applies to a hippy consumer trying to have fun in the bush applies tenfold to the military!
